Trends which are changing the Corrugated Board Industry
21 May 2024
Corrugated board manufacturers have seen a range of factors influence their industry over the last few years; from growing e-commerce to changing consumer preferences. Increased production requirements can make modernising your process with effective and efficient solutions an essential part of staying competitive.

Economic Growth
Ecommerce retail sales are continuing to increase; global sales are expected to be over $7.9 trillion by 2027.
This will massively increase the demand for corrugated board, with 80% of the packaging being corrugated. From individual packaging and bulk shipping, to protective wraps, corrugated board manufacturers have innovated new way to serve the e-commerce industry and replace plastic alternatives.
Client Requirements
E-commerce has historically burdened the consumer with bulky plastic filler packaging that is not domestically recyclable.
Modern e-commerce retailers now focus on providing bespoke packaging solutions with minimal void filler required, reducing shipping costs and the amount of packaging for the consumer to dispose of.
Many corrugated board manufacturers are finding their customers require a large variety of board sizes to suit consumer needs, as well as recyclable void fill alternatives like shredded or honeycombed board.
The volume and variety of scrap produced can require significant modifications to existing scrap systems, or with the introduction of new machinery, more modern scrap extraction and conveyance systems can be integrated into growing manufacturing facilities.
Consumer trends
Corrugated board is one of the most commonly recycled materials in the UK with domestic recycling easily available to the majority of the population; this appeals greatly to eco-friendly consumers and has led many retailers to utilise ‘100% recyclable’ packaging as a selling point for their products.
